Transferring Property Ownership Through Gifts: Legal Considerations for Donating Real Estate
Gifting real estate can be a straightforward process with various legal implications. It's essential to understand the necessities involved to ensure a smooth and legally sound allocation of ownership. Before embarking on this journey, it's highly recommended to seek guidance from an experienced real estate attorney who can give expert advice tailored to your individual circumstances.
A thorough legal review will help pinpoint any potential problems and ensure the gift is executed in accordance with applicable state laws and regulations. Some key legal considerations include:
- Establishing the fair market value of the property
- Formulating a legally valid gift deed or transfer document
- Filing the deed with the appropriate government authority
- Addressing potential tax implications for both the granter and the recipient
By carefully evaluating these legal aspects, you can make certain that the transfer of property ownership through a gift is a smooth and legally sound process.
Transferring Real Estate to External Entities: Tax Implications
When exploring the act of donating real estate to external entities, it's crucial to meticulously understand the potential tax implications. Donations of real property can often result in significant savings, but the specifics rely on various factors. These variables include the fair market value of the property, the beneficiary's status, and the donor's overall financial circumstances.
It is strongly recommended to consult with a qualified tax professional to assess the specific tax consequences related to your donation. They can help you maximize potential deductions and confirm compliance with all applicable tax laws.

Effective Strategies for Donating Assets to Non-Profit Organizations
Donating property to non-profit organizations can be a valuable way to support causes you care in. To ensure your donation is beneficial, consider these effective strategies. First, identify non-profits that align with your values. Contact the organization proactively to discuss your donation and their unique needs.
Next, thoroughly evaluate the value of the property you wish to donate. Obtaining a professional appraisal can help both you and the non-profit in understanding its market value. Finally, seek advice with a financial advisor to understand the potential taxbenefits associated with your donation. By following these strategies, you can make a positive contribution while also enjoying possible tax advantages.
